Christine McVie's Journey: A Brief Overview
Before we dive into the sad news, let's take a quick look at Christine McVie's incredible journey. Born on July 12, 1943, in Birmingham, England, Christine Perfect started her musical career in the 1960s, playing in various bands before joining Fleetwood Mac in 1970. She married the band's founder, John McVie, in 1968, and together, they became one of the most iconic duos in rock history.
Christine's songwriting skills and powerful vocals contributed significantly to Fleetwood Mac's success. She co-wrote and sang some of the band's most beloved hits, like "Don't Stop," "Little Lies," "Everywhere," and "Songbird." Her unique ability to blend pop, rock, and blues elements created a sound that has stood the test of time.
When Did Christine McVie Pass Away? The Sad News
On November 30, 2022, the music world was stunned by the news that Christine McVie had passed away. She was 79 years old. The cause of her death was revealed to be a long and brave battle with cancer, which she had kept private. Christine McVie's Induction into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ame
In 1998, Christine McVie was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ame as a member of Fleetwood Mac. This well-deserved honor recognized her significant contributions to the band's success and her lasting impact on the music industry.
